The MCP1703AT-2052E/CB belongs to the category of voltage regulators.
This product is commonly used in electronic circuits to regulate and stabilize voltage levels.
The MCP1703AT-2052E/CB comes in a compact SOT-23 package, which is widely used for surface mount applications.
The essence of this product lies in its ability to maintain a stable output voltage despite variations in the input voltage or load conditions.

Question: What is the maximum input voltage for MCP1703AT-2052E/CB?
Answer: The maximum input voltage for MCP1703AT-2052E/CB is 16V.
Question: What is the typical output voltage of MCP1703AT-2052E/CB?
Answer: The typical output voltage of MCP1703AT-2052E/CB is 5.0V.
Question: What is the maximum output current of MCP1703AT-2052E/CB?
Answer: The maximum output current of MCP1703AT-2052E/CB is 250mA.
Question: What is the dropout voltage of MCP1703AT-2052E/CB?
Answer: The dropout voltage of MCP1703AT-2052E/CB is typically 178mV at 100mA load.
Question: Is MCP1703AT-2052E/CB suitable for battery-powered applications?
Answer: Yes, MCP1703AT-2052E/CB is suitable for battery-powered applications due to its low quiescent current.
Question: Can MCP1703AT-2052E/CB be used in automotive electronics?
Answer: Yes, MCP1703AT-2052E/CB is suitable for automotive electronics applications.
Question: What is the operating temperature range of MCP1703AT-2052E/CB?
Answer: The operating temperature range of MCP1703AT-2052E/CB is -40°C to 125°C.
Question: Does MCP1703AT-2052E/CB require external capacitors for stability?
Answer: Yes, MCP1703AT-2052E/CB requires an input and output capacitor for stability.
